I am facing a problem in LMS 2.6 Common services, Device and credentials, Device management.When i select a particular device and view its credentials, in the report page under the hostname field i see the ip address of the device. This is the case for all devices. I tried to manually change it to hostname , but after device discovery it reverts back to ip address. I installed LMS on another machine the same issue exists. I would like to see hostname under the hostname field instead of the IP address. I have common services 3.0.3.
How can this be rectfied?Pls help!!

I don't believe that can be changed. My system is the same way.
If you're wanting to view a "Friendly" name in Topology view then edit the device's credential and give it a "Display Name". Then in Topology View>Display Labels> select Show Device Name.
Select Show Sysname to view the device's actual hostname. Same as when you terminal into the device. I suppose that IP address is used when selecting Show Device Name. If true then it would be possible to falsely display the hostname by simply inserting an IP Address of another device.

In discovery options i unchecked the "use reverse DNS Lookup". Then in device management
i manually added host names, applied changes, ran device discovery & data collection and the hostnames persisted instead of ip addresses.
